2007 Suzuki Boulevard Review

Intro

The Suzuki Boulevard offers the most options, different models and accessories of almost all of the motorbikes currently available on the market. The base MSRP for the Suzuki Boulevard C50 cruiser is around $6,800, the 2007 Suzuki Boulevard M109R is around $13,000 and the S83 model has a base MSRP of around $8,500. The Boulevard series has five different sized engines and compression ratios amongst the models. There are Boulevard models with fuel injection or dual carburetors as well. Riders can choose from SOHC or DOHC models, six different wheelbase sizes and fuel tank sizes and three different heights for seats as well. There are a total of 14 different models available for the 2007 Suzuki Boulevard series.

Many riders favor the 2007 Suzuki Boulevard C50 because it’s an easy bike to handle on the road. The 2007 C50 can be an ideal starter bike for novice riders looking to have fun while cruising around town. Some riders complain that the seat can get uncomfortable after riding for extensive periods of time. The engine for the C50 model gets lively at around 80 to 85 mph but has no trouble in maintaining stability at these high speeds. Many riders average around 48 mpg with these motorbikes. The C50 can be a great choice for commuters looking for a fun way to get around the local area.

New For 2007

  • There were a few changes for the Suzuki Boulevard series in 2007. The M50 Black model from 2006 was dropped from the series for 2007. The 2007 launch also brought the new M50 Limited and M109R Limited Edition models to the market. Many of the 2007 Suzuki Boulevard models have the same MSRP as the 2006 models and there were no significant changes made to the engine, brakes, tires or transmission. The most significant changes to these motorbikes were typically aesthetic.

2007 Suzuki Boulevard Specs

  • Boulevard S40, S50, S83, C50, C50 Black, C50C, C50T, M50, M50 Limited,
  • C90, C90 Black, C90T, M109R, M109R Limited Edition
  • Engine Type: 655 cc single-cylinder 4-stroke; 819 cc, 1475 cc, 1360 cc, 1783 cc two-cylinder 4-stroke v twin
  • Bore and Stroke: 3.7 x 3.7, 3.27 x 2.93 inches, 3.7 x 3.86, 3.78 x 3.98, 4.41 x 3.57,
  • Compression ratio: 8:5:1, 10:0:1, 9:3:1, 9:4:1, 10:5:1
  • Valve Train: SOHC, DOHC
  • Induction: Mikuni Carburetor, Fuel injected
  • Ignition: Electric
  • Transmission: 5-speed manual
  • Final Drive: N/A
  • Fuel Capacity: 2.8 gallons, 3.2 gallons, 3.4 gallons, 4.1 gallons, 3.7 gallons, 5.2 gallons
  • Estimated Fuel Economy: N/A
  • Brakes (Front): Hydraulic Disc, Hydraulic Disc, Dual Hydraulic Disc
  • Brakes (Rear): Drum, Hydraulic Disc, Hydraulic Disc
  • Suspension (Front): Telescopic fork, Inverted Fork
  • Suspension (Rear): Twin Sided Swing Arm
  • Wheelbase: 58.3 inches, 61.4 inches, 63.5 inches, 65.2 inches, 66.9 inches, 67.3 inches
  • Rake: N/A
  • Trail: N/A
  • Seat Height: 27.6 inches, 27.8 inches, 29.1 inches
  • Curb Weight: 352 pounds, 443 pounds, 535 pounds, 542 pounds, 544 pounds, 567 pounds, 665 pounds, 695 pounds, 703 pounds
  • Tires (Front): 100/90 R19 57H, 100/90 R19 57H, 110/90 R19 62H, 130/90 R16, 150/80 R16, Dunlop 130/70 R18 M/C 63V
  • Tires (Rear): 140/80 R15 67H, 140/90 R15 70H, 170/80 R15 77H, 170/80 R15, 180/70 R15, Dunlop 240/40 R18 M/C 79V
